tp官方下载安卓最新版本2024_tpwallet最新版本 | TP官方app下载/苹果正版安装-TP官方网址下载

TP操作教程综合解读:去中心化借贷、多币种钱包与Golang级支付系统

一、TP操作教程:从“可执行流程”到“系统化方案”

在做TP(Transaction/Transfer/Transfer Protocol等具体实现可能因业务而异)操作时,最关键的不是记住某一步命令,而是形成一套可重复、可审计、可扩展的流程:

1)明确业务目标与约束

- 资金是走链上还是链下?

- 是否需要原路退回、分账、托管或可撤销?

- 合规要求:KYC/AML、交易留痕、风控规则。

- 性能要求:延迟上限、吞吐量、失败重试策略。

2)准备必要组件

- 钱包与密钥管理:建议使用分层确定性HD钱包或托管/非托管混合方案。

- 交易构建器(Tx Builder):负责组装交易字段、签名载荷、手续费与Gas估算。

- 网络接入(RPC/节点/网关):稳定性与故障切换要提前设计。

- 监控与审计:交易状态回执、日志、告警、链上索引。

3)执行TP的标准步骤(通用版)

- Step A:读取账户状态(余额、nonce/sequence、链ID、费率)。

- Step B:计算金额与手续费(含滑点/价格影响时需做动态校验)。

- Step C:构建交易(to/from、value、data、gas limit、max fee/max priority)。

- Step D:签名并发送(离线签名优先;发送需幂等标识)。

- Step E:等待确认(区块确认数阈值、超时重试、回滚策略)。

- Step F:落库与对账(交易哈希/订单号映射、失败原因分类)。

4)常见风险与排错

- 余额不足:包括“预留手续费”问题。

- nonce/sequence冲突:并发发送需锁或用序列队列。

- 链ID/网络配置错误:测试网/主网混淆。

- 费率波动:EIP-1559类机制需动态调整。

- 合约调用失败:先做模拟(dry-run)或估算gas。

二、专家解读:去中心化借贷(DeFi Lending)与TP操作的耦合点

去中心化借贷通常涉及:存款(供给)、借款(借入)、清算(liquidation)、利率变化、抵押品状态与清算阈值。把它映射到TP操作教程,专家更关注“交易时序”和“状态可观测性”。

1)DeFi借贷中的核心变量

- 抵押率(LTV)、清算阈值与健康度(Health Factor)。

- 借贷利率模型(可变/稳定等不同协议差异)。

- 资产价格预言机(Oracle)更新频率与异常风险。

2)“供给/借入/还款”对应TP操作

- 供给:需要构建“授权(approve)+存入(deposit)”或直接合约调用交易。

- 借入:在借出前必须检查抵押授权、健康度、可借额度。

- 还款:涉及利息结算、精确金额计算与代币精度。

- 清算:通常是第三方执行,TP策略侧重“触发条件监测+快速执行”。

3)专家建议的工程实践

- 先模拟再签名:对合约调用做预估(simulate/estimate gas)。

- 交易幂等:同一订单号对应唯一交易路径,避免重复扣款。

- 风控门槛:若健康度或预估清算概率超过阈值,拒绝提交。

- 状态订阅:通过链上事件(logs)驱动业务状态,而非仅轮询。

三、全球化技术趋势:从多链互通到跨境支付的“无缝体验”

全球化推动了技术栈的变化:

- 多链时代:不同地区用户习惯不同网络与资产。

- 跨境合规:需要交易可审计、可追踪。

- 统一用户体验:同一业务目标映射到多链、多资产、多费率。

1)趋势一:跨链与多路由支付

高级系统不会把“发送”写死在单一链或单一通道,而是提供路由层:

- 根据链拥堵与费率自动选择网络。

- 根据代币流动性选择兑换路径(如聚合器/路由器)。

- 根据失败原因切换后备路径(fallback)。

2)趋势二:事件驱动与可观测性

“全球化”不仅是网络覆盖,更是系统可观测:

- 分布式追踪(Trace ID)贯穿构建、签名、发送、确认、落库。

- 指标(TPS、确认耗时、失败率)与告警联动。

3)趋势三:合规与隐私平衡

- 交易留痕与风险评分。

- 对敏感信息脱敏存储。

- 对链上数据与链下KYC数据做关联治理(权限控制)。

四、先进数字化系统:把TP变成“端到端可交付能力”

一个先进数字化系统通常具备以下层级:

1)资产与账户层(Asset/Account Layer)

- 统一账户模型:Address、链ID、代币元数据(精度、合约地址)。

- 多链余额聚合与缓存一致性。

2)交易编排层(Orchestration)

- 交易模板化:把“借入/还款/供给/换币/转账”做成可配置流水线。

- 规则引擎:费用阈值、滑点容忍、清算保护等。

- 状态机:Submitted → Pending → Confirmed/Failed,确保不丢状态。

3)安全层(Security)

- 密钥隔离:HSM/TEE或托管服务与审计。

- 签名风控:地址黑名单、异常金额、频率限制。

- 反重放:nonce/sequence管理与链ID校验。

4)对账与结算层(Reconciliation)

- 订单系统与链上交易哈希映射。

- 失败原因分类与自动补偿(重新路由/人工审批)。

五、多币种钱包:从“能用”到“可扩展与可监管”

多币种钱包不只是“存多种代币”,而是要处理代币差异与安全边界。

1)代币与链的统一抽象

- 同一资产在不同链的表示不同(主币/代币合约/包装币)。

- 需维护 Token Registry:符号、精度、合约地址、最小转账单位。

2)钱包类型策略

- 非托管:用户私钥本地/离线签名,安全性高但运维复杂。

- 托管/半托管:提升可用性与恢复能力,但需更强合规与风控。

- 混合:关键操作离线签名、日常操作托管/路由。

3)交易费用与余额预留

- 发送某代币时仍需主币支付Gas。

- 多币种场景要动态预留Gas余额,避免“明明余额够代币却失败”。

4)安全与备份

- 助记词/私钥加密与分片备份。

- 地址簿与权限管理(多签/角色)。

六、高级支付方案:面向“快、稳、可扩展”的支付路由

高级支付方案强调:低失败率、高速度、可审计、可追踪。

1)支付路由(Payment Routing)

- 链路选择:主网/侧链/Layer2 或不同网络。

- 资产路由:若目标资产流动性不足,可先兑换中间资产再到达。

- 费率路由:根据拥堵预测动态调整费用出价。

2)滑点与预估机制

- 对兑换与借贷类交易应在提交前预估结果。

- 设置滑点容忍、最小输出(minOut)与交易条件。

3)失败重试与回滚

- 幂等重试:相同订单号不要生成不同“扣款行为”。

- 分层重试:仅重试发送不重试构建/签名(防止签名漂移)。

- 人工兜底:当触发特定风控(价格异常、健康度过低)时进入审批。

4)合规与审计

- 交易与用户、订单、风控策略关联记录。

- 可导出报表与审计日志留存。

七、Golang:用于TP系统的工程实现要点

Golang适合做高并发、事件驱动与稳定服务端组件。下面给出面向实现的要点(偏架构而非具体业务代码)。

1)并发与队列

- 使用worker pool处理交易构建/签名/发送。

- 为每个账户(或nonce域)建立串行队列,避免nonce冲突。

2)上下文与超时控制

- transaction级别使用context.WithTimeout。

- RPC调用与确认等待都要可取消、可重试。

3)幂等与状态机

- 以订单号/幂等Key作为主键,落库状态机。

- 明确状态转移与重入逻辑,避免重复提交。

4)链上事件与索引

- 监听区块头或事件日志(logs),用索引服务落库。

- 对重组(reorg)做保护:确认数阈值、回滚处理。

5)安全与密钥管理

- 密钥不落明文日志。

- 若使用托管签名,需做签名请求鉴权与速率限制。

6)可观测性

- structured logging(如zap/zerolog)。

- 指标(Prometheus)与链路追踪(OpenTelemetry)。

- 告警(失败率、延迟、确认超时)。

八、小结:把TP操作教程落到“系统能力”

综合以上内容,TP操作教程的真正价值在于:

- 从流程化步骤,延伸到去中心化借贷的状态依赖与风控。

- 结合全球化技术趋势,构建多链、多资产、可路由的支付能力。

- 用先进数字化系统实现端到端可交付:监控、对账、审计一体化。

- 通过多币种钱包抽象差异、降低失败率并提升安全。

- 最终用Golang打造高并发、可靠的交易编排与支付路由服务。

如果你希望我进一步“落地到可运行的教程”,请告诉我:TP在你场景里具体指的是哪种操作(转账协议、交易类型、还是某平台的TP命令),以及目标链/代币与是否需要DeFi借贷集成。

作者:林岚舟发布时间:2026-05-03 17:55:06

评论

相关阅读